Stream: git-wasmtime

Topic: wasmtime / PR #7416 Add support for `::` in `--dir` to ol...


view this post on Zulip Wasmtime GitHub notifications bot (Oct 30 2023 at 21:33):

alexcrichton opened PR #7416 from alexcrichton:fix-double-colon-in-dir to bytecodealliance:main:

In Wasmtime 13 and prior the --dir argument was unconditionally used to open a host dir as the same name and in the guest. In Wasmtime 14+ though this argument is being repurposed with an optional trailing ::GUEST to configure the guest directory. This means that --dir-with-remapping behavior is actually unusable without the environment variable configuration from #7385 due to it parsing differently in the old and the new.

This commit updates the situation by adding ::-parsing to the old CLI meaning that both the old and the new parse this the same way. This will break any scripts that open host directories with two colons in their path, but that seems niche enough we can handle that later.

<!--
Please make sure you include the following information:

Our development process is documented in the Wasmtime book:
https://docs.wasmtime.dev/contributing-development-process.html

Please ensure all communication follows the code of conduct:
https://github.com/bytecodealliance/wasmtime/blob/main/CODE_OF_CONDUCT.md
-->

view this post on Zulip Wasmtime GitHub notifications bot (Oct 30 2023 at 21:33):

alexcrichton requested fitzgen for a review on PR #7416.

view this post on Zulip Wasmtime GitHub notifications bot (Oct 30 2023 at 21:33):

alexcrichton requested wasmtime-core-reviewers for a review on PR #7416.

view this post on Zulip Wasmtime GitHub notifications bot (Oct 30 2023 at 23:51):

fitzgen submitted PR review.

view this post on Zulip Wasmtime GitHub notifications bot (Oct 31 2023 at 00:34):

fitzgen merged PR #7416.


Last updated: Oct 23 2024 at 20:03 UTC